Abstract

A discharge grate assembly in a discharge end wall system in a mill shell of a grinding mill. The mill shell defines a mill shell chamber in which a charge including grinding balls and ore-bearing rocks is positioned. The mill shell is rotatable about a central axis thereof for comminution of the ore-bearing rocks to form the grinding balls into worn grinding balls and to produce a slurry including liquid and worn rock pieces from the ore-bearing rocks. The discharge grate assembly includes a body with elongate apertures therein, each aperture extending between a first end thereof and a wider second end thereof. The first and second ends of the aperture are partially defined by respective first and second end walls that are at least partially rectilinear, for impeding the worn grinding balls and the worn rock pieces from lodging in the aperture.

Claims (56)

1. A grinding mill, comprising:

a shell defining a mill shell chamber therein in which a charge including grinding balls and ore-bearing rocks is positioned, the shell being rotatable in a predetermined direction about a central axis thereof for comminution of the ore-bearing rocks to produce a mixture including a fluid and worn rock pieces from the ore-bearing rocks, wherein the commnution of the ore-bearing rocks forms the grinding balls into worn grinding balls;

a discharge end wall attached to the shell, the discharge end wall extending between an outer edge thereof connected to the shell and an inner edge thereof at least partially defining a central opening in the discharge end wall; and

a discharge end wall system, comprising:

a plurality of discharge grate assemblies; and

a plurality of pulp chambers located between the respective discharge grate assemblies and the discharge end wall, for directing the mixture received therein toward the central opening, to exit the grinding mill therethrough,

wherein each said discharge grate assembly is positioned to screen the mixture flowing from the mill shell chamber into each said pulp chamber respectively as the shell rotates about the central axis,

wherein each said discharge grate assembly is rotatable with the shell about the central axis between a lowered condition, in which the mixture is flowable through at least part of each said discharge grate assembly into the pulp chamber adjacent thereto respectively, and a raised condition, in which the discharge grate assembly is positioned above the charge, and

wherein each said discharge grate assembly comprises:

a body comprising a plurality of elongate apertures therein, formed to screen the mixture flowing therethrough from the mill shell chamber into the pulp chamber,

wherein each said aperture extends between respective first and second ends thereof, the first end having a predetermined first end width and the second end of the aperture having a predetermined second end width that is larger than the first end width,

wherein each said aperture is defined by aperture walls formed in the body; and

wherein the aperture walls comprise first and second end walls that are at least partially rectilinear and partially define the first and second ends respectively, the first and second end walls being formed to impede the worn grinding balls and the worn rock pieces in the mixture from lodging in the aperture.
